His band Promise of the Real even became Cooper’s backing group on screen. After watching Nelson perform onstage with Neil Young, Cooper tapped the artist for assistance Nelson ended up overseeing the movie’s sound and helping Cooper fine tune his character. At the 2019 Golden Globes, Gaga and her co-writers took home the Best Original Song trophy for “Shallow,” teeing her up nicely for an Academy Award nomination.Ī murderer’s row of musical talent-from rocker Lukas Nelson to English musician and DJ Mark Ronson to country singer-songwriter Jason Isbell-helped build that soundtrack. Meanwhile, the certified-platinum soundtrack topped the Billboard chart when it debuted in October, besting recent soundtrack records, knocking down releases from popular artists like Lil Wayne and even topping Gaga’s own previous chart successes as a solo artist. The film has handily beaten the domestic box-office numbers of live-action musicals like La La Land and Les Miserables, raking in nearly $400 million globally.
